Kentucky Game Televised on Fox Sports South

| By:
November 7, 2011 -- The Morehouse exhibition basketball game against the University of Kentucky Wildcats will be televised, Monday (Nov. 7), at 7 p.m., on FOX Sports South.  

Kentucky is the preseason #2 team in Division I and the #1 seed in the Southeastern Conference. The Wildcats are expected to make a deep run in the NCAA tournament.

This is the first meeting between Morehouse and the 7-time NCAA champion Wildcats. The game will be played in Lexington, KY, at the Adolph Rupp Arena, the largest basketball venue in the nation. More than 23,000 fans are expected to attend.

The game was arranged by Morehouse head coach Grady Brewer who met Kentucky head coach John Calipari at the ESPN Town Hall, held at Morehouse, in January.

Coach Cal asked to take a picture with the Morehouse basketball team at the summit and Brewer agreed in exchange for an exhibition match up against the Maroon Tigers. 

Morehouse Director of Athletics Andre Pattillo, a former SEC referee, has deep ties to the Kentucky basketball program.
